Small Parts Cause Big Leaks Over Time

P-traps crack. Valves stop shutting off. Supply lines wear down or burst. If left alone, even a slow drip under the sink can lead to bigger water damage. Signs you may need service:

Our 4-Step Valve Replacement Process

Inspection & Estimate

We look under the sink, test the shutoff valve, inspect the supply line, and check for leaks. Then we give you a quote before any work starts.

Drain and Prep

We shut off the water, release any pressure in the lines, and prep the area. We lay down covers and get the fittings ready for the new install.

Remove & Replace

We take out the worn valve, P-trap, or line. New parts are fitted, sealed, and tightened by hand and tool for a solid connection.

Test and Clean Up

We turn the water back on, check all joints, and test the flow. If there’s no leak, we clean the space and remove the old parts.
